ABF Names Squad For West Asia Baseball Cup
KABUL (Pajhwok): The Afghanistan Baseball Federation (ABF) has named a 20-member squad for the upcoming 2025 West Asia Baseball Cup.
The tournament is scheduled to begin tomorrow (Thursday) in Karaj, Iran. ABF announced the team on its Facebook page.
Squad:Abdul Ghafour (captain), Karamat, Dilawar, Usman Ghani, Sirajuddin, Ahmadullah, Tariq, Habibullah, Allah Mohammad, Kashif Ahmad, Ehsanullah, Usman, Najm
- Islam, Mohammad Asif, Sediqullah, Aziz Khan, Amir Khan, Matiullah, Dost Mohammad and Sulaiman.
National teams from Afghanistan, Palestine, India, Sri Lanka, Iran, Pakistan and Bangladesh are participating in this year's event.
The Afghan squad, which arrived in Karaj city on Tuesday, will kick off its campaign against Palestine on 16 May.
Afghanistan has been placed in group A alongside Palestine, India and Sri Lanka.
Afghanistan will take on Sri Lanka in their second match on May 17 and their final group-stage fixture will be against India on May 18.
